How much do service readiness coordinator j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for service readiness coordinator in the United States is $22.64,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.99 and $24.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Participant Readiness CoordinatorAbout the Role

We are seeking a detail-oriented Participant Readiness Coordinator to support an ongoing user research study. This role is responsible for screening participants, collecting vital signs and baseline health metrics, determining study eligibility, and ensuring compliance with standardized protocols.

This position is ideal for candidates with experience in participant screening, health assessments, clinical research, or healthcare environments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ct structured participant intake and eligibility interviews (approximately 6 per day).
  • Collect and document vital signs and baseline physiological measurements.
  • Administer standardized health and readiness questionnaires.
  • Evaluate participant data against study criteria to determine participation eligibility.
  • Accurately maintain study records and documentation.
  • Communicate eligibility outcomes to participants and study leads.
  • Ensure strict adherence to study protocols and procedures.
Required Qualifications
  • Experience taking and documenting vital signs (blood pressure, heart rate, oxygen saturation, etc.).
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to follow standardized procedures.
  • Experience conducting screenings, assessments, interviews, or participant intake.
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ills.
  • Comfortable using digital tools and data-entry systems.
  • Ability to make objective decisions based on predefined criteria.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in clinical research, healthcare, wellness, or participant-focused programs.
  • Experience as a Medical Assistant, EMT, CNA, Health Screener, Clinical Research Coordinator, Exercise Science professional, or similar.
Key Skills
  • Protocol Adherence & Accuracy
  • Vital Signs Collection & Health Screening
  • Eligibility Assessment & Decision-Making
  • Structured Interviewing
  • Data Integrity & Documentation
  • Professional Communication
  • Technical Literacy
